Analyst/Researcher – London/Remote - Podcasts! Leaders in entertainment research & intelligence
London/Remote - Up to £45,000
This agency are experts at helping media and entertainment businesses understand their audiences through data-driven insights. Focused on the ever-changing world of digital content, the team here are bold, innovative, and passionate about what they do.
The previously defined world of radio, music, and books is becoming blurred, and therefore they are looking a new Audio Analyst to join their newly defined Audio Research vertical and play a pivotal role in analysing data in the audio marketplace – with a particular focus on the ever-growing popularity of podcasts!
The successful candidate will need to be able to demonstrate a genuine interest and understanding of the audio world (particularly podcasts), have great critical thinking skills and significant experience gained within a strategy, research, or analysis role in the commercial world.
Taking the lead on the podcast research, analysis, and consultancy, you will need to be confident in your ability to run research projects from start to finish and have top report writing and presentation skills. Building relationships with clients will be key, and you will be encouraged to input your own ideas into the agency’s thought leadership and help build new concepts within the wider research team. The ability to examine data and extract meaningful insights will be essential and you will need strong written and verbal communication skills.
